PUERTO RICO OPEN PRESENTED BY SEEPUERTORICO.COM


March 10, 2013


Jordan Spieth


RIO GRANDE, PUERTO RICO

Q.  Just give us some quick thoughts on the ending here. 
JORDAN SPIETH:  Yeah, at the beginning of the round I had told Michael that I think I was going to have to shoot six.  So I told him after each hole let me know how many I need left.  And got to 5‑under through 10 there and thought that maybe I would need to get at 21 or so.  Those guys were at 21, 22 at the time.
You know, I tried to play conservative golf, tried to hit the greens, give myself eight chances after No. 10, eight looks at birdie.  And you know, just one short.  Didn't get up‑and‑down on 15 or 16, and it cost me.
But all in all, obviously I'm real excited with how the week ended, and I would have taken second at the beginning of the week if you told me.
It was cool to battle on the back nine there and know that I was close in the heat and feel the pressure.  First‑time experience for me.

Q.  Top 10 you'll be into next week.  What's your thoughts on continuing out here?
JORDAN SPIETH:  Yeah.  I just played three in a row, so I'm pretty worn out.  I may sleep for a couple of days and get out there and just try and keep on riding the momentum and see what happens.
Coming in here I was hitting the ball well and struggling a little with the putter, and now I've come out of it knowing that my stroke's a lot better.  I feel really confident for the rest of the year.
